First bedtime with no BFing. SUCKS!

Tonight is the first night I have officially quit breastfeeding (I have been doing it once a day at night for a few months). UGH... she won't go to sleep! Cries "mama" and is standing in her crib. Apparently my new nighttime routine of bath, PJS, brush teeth, story/rocking and bed isn't working for her. This sucks!

    I substituted breast with a milk sippy at first and then with a sippy of water to make the transition easier.  We just sit on the couch, where we always nursed, cuddle and he drinks before bed.  We also walked with him in his room a little longer so he got some extra cuddle time.  I hope it gets easier soon.  I know how hard and guilt ridden it can be at first but she'll be fine.. promise.
